Learning About Hip Dysplasia: Meaning and Development

Hip dysplasia is a prevalent and complicated developmental condition impacting the hip joints of dogs. It happens when the hip joint does not align correctly into the hip socket, resulting in instability. This structural abnormality can stem from a combination of genetic components, external conditions, and accelerated growth during puppyhood. Particular breeds, notably bigger varieties, are more susceptible to this condition.

The onset of hip dysplasia commonly begins early in life, with symptoms often emerging as the dog grows. In some cases, the disorder may progress to osteoarthritis, leading to additional complications. Proper nutrition, controlled exercise, and weight management play vital roles in reducing the risks associated with hip dysplasia. Early diagnosis and intervention can greatly improve a dog's quality of life, emphasizing the importance of regular veterinary check-ups. Understanding this condition's nature is crucial for dog owners to ensure their pets receive appropriate care.

General Clinical Signs of Hip Dysplasia

While many dogs may first present no signs, frequent signs of hip dysplasia often become noticeable as they mature. Affected dogs may show a significant drop in engagement in physical activities, leading to disinclination toward play or exercise. Owners might spot a characteristic "bunny hop" gait, where the dog moves both hind legs simultaneously rather than alternating them. Limping or inflexibility, notably after periods of rest, can also be revealing of the condition.

Additionally, dogs may struggle to rise from a lying position or show signs of discomfort when climbing stairs or jumping. Weight gain can occur due to decreased mobility, further worsening joint issues. Changes in behavior, such as irritability or withdrawal, may also arise as dogs experience pain. Recognizing these symptoms early can be vital for timely treatment and control of hip dysplasia, ultimately improving the dog's overall well-being.

Which Types Have a Greater Susceptibility of Hip Dysplasia?

Some canine varieties are prone to hip dysplasia due to hereditary elements and their physical structure. Large and giant breeds, such as German Shepherds, Golden Retrievers, Rottweilers, and St. Bernards, are particularly vulnerable. These dogs often have a combination of weight and skeletal conformation that places extra stress on their hip joints.

Mid-sized varieties such as Bulldogs and Boxers also undergo heightened risk, as their unusual body structures can cause hip joint deformation. Furthermore, certain miniature breeds, including Dachshunds and Cocker Spaniels, may experience hip dysplasia, though less often than bigger breeds.

Grasping breed predisposition is essential for dog owners and breeders alike, as it reveals the importance of responsible breeding practices and early recognition. Regular vet consultations can help uncover potential issues before they worsen, ensuring a healthier life for these endangered breeds.

Genetics and Environment: Important Factors in Hip Dysplasia

Comprehending the connection between genetic and environmental factors is important in treating hip dysplasia in dogs. The condition is considerably influenced by genetic factors, with certain breeds inclined to developing hip dysplasia due to inherited traits. Genetic changes affecting joint formation can lead to improper development, heightening the likelihood of hip dysplasia.

Environmental factors also play a critical role. Obesity, for example, places additional tension on a dog's hips, exacerbating the risk of dysplasia. In addition, inadequate sustenance during growth phases can lead to skeletal abnormalities. Overexertion during initial developmental stages, particularly in large breeds, can further be part of joint difficulties.

In the end, a combination of genetic factors and surroundings creates a multifaceted risk profile for hip dysplasia. Understanding these components allows pet owners and breeders to make well-informed choices, conceivably mitigating the prevalence of this debilitating condition in dogs.

Surgical Solutions Alternatives

Surgical intervention offers a variety of choices for dogs affected by hip dysplasia, designed to alleviating pain and improving mobility. The most common procedures comprise femoral head ostectomy (FHO) and total hip replacement (THR). FHO entails removing the femoral head, allowing the body to create a false joint, which can reduce pain. Total hip replacement, conversely, replaces the entire hip joint with a prosthetic, resulting in better function and decreased discomfort. Another option is the triple pelvic osteotomy (TPO), which repositions the hip socket to more effectively support the femur. The choice of procedure relies on the dog's age, severity of dysplasia, and overall health, requiring thoughtful evaluation by veterinary professionals to ensure optimal outcomes.

Pharmaceutical Treatment and Ache Management

Effective management of hip dysplasia in dogs often involves a mix of drugs and pain relief methods aimed at improving well-being. Non-copyrightal anti-inflammatory drugs (NSAIDs) are commonly prescribed to reduce inflammation and ease discomfort, allowing for better mobility. In some cases, veterinarians may recommend glucosamine and chondroitin supplements to promote joint health and function. Corticocopyrights may also be used for their anti-inflammatory effects, although they have potential side effects with long-term use. Pain management may additionally involve the use of opioids for more severe discomfort. Careful observation and adjustments to drug types and dosages are essential, as individual responses can differ significantly among dogs, ensuring ideal care and comfort throughout the treatment process.

Lifestyle and Restoration Solutions

Lifestyle and rehabilitation strategies play an essential role in managing hip dysplasia in dogs. Regular, controlled exercise helps maintain muscle strength and joint flexibility, reducing discomfort. Low-impact activities, such as swimming and walking on soft surfaces, are particularly beneficial. Weight management is vital; maintaining a healthy body condition can alleviate stress on the hips. Additionally, physical therapy techniques, including massage and stretching, can enhance mobility and improve overall quality of life. Joint supplements, like glucosamine and omega-3 fatty acids, may also support joint health. Providing a comfortable resting area, using orthopedic beds, and avoiding excessive jumping or stair climbing further contribute to a dog's well-being. Together, these strategies foster a more active, pain-free lifestyle for dogs dealing with hip dysplasia.

Frequently Requested FAQs

Can Hip Dysplasia Be Identified Through a Blood Sample?

Hip dysplasia is not diagnosable through a lab test. Assessment usually requires physical examinations, medical background, and imaging tools like X-rays to determine joint structure and function, offering a thorough grasp of the condition.

Does Hip Dysplasia Trigger Discomfort for Dogs?

Hip dysplasia may be agonizing for dogs, since it results in joint instability and degenerative joint disease. Symptoms often include hobbling, difficulty rising, and reluctance to engage in physical activities, diminishing their overall quality of life.

How Can I Stop Hip Dysplasia in My Puppy?

Hip dysplasia in puppies can be avoided through maintaining a healthy weight, providing balanced nutrition, ensuring appropriate exercise, and limiting high-impact activities and vigorous play, which serve as helpful approaches to support correct joint formation and reduce risk.

Are There Other Therapies for Hip Dysplasia?

Alternative approaches for hip dysplasia include acupuncture, physical therapy, and chiropractic adjustments. Additionally, supplements like glucosamine and omega-3 fatty acids may help minimize pain and optimize mobility, supporting overall joint health in affected dogs.

What Determines the Lifespan of a Dog With Hip Dysplasia?

A dog with hip dysplasia can live a normal lifespan, usually 10 to 15 years, depending on factors like intensity, care, and overall health. Care through diet, exercise, and professional veterinary support significantly impacts longevity.
